Brianna is taking a writing assessment that has 3 sections. She has a total of 5/6 of an hour to finish all the sections. If she is allowed the same amount of time to finish each section, how much time does she have to spend on each section?(1 point)

To find out how much time Brianna has to spend on each section, we need to divide the total time she has by the number of sections.

The total time Brianna has is 5/6 of an hour.
Since there are 3 sections, we divide the total time by the number of sections: (5/6) / 3 = <<(5/6)/3=5/18>>5/18.
Therefore, Brianna has 5/18 of an hour to spend on each section. Answer: \boxed{\frac{5}{18} \text{ hour}}.
